          Orlando Magic at New Jersey Nets [7:35 PM ET]

          Magic (-5.5, O/U 196.5): The Magic have lost three of six to drop two games behind Boston for the #2 seed in the East. Orlando was averaging 102.2 points after a 116-87 victory over Cleveland on April 3, but has scored just 86.8 points over their last four. “We’re playing awful basketball,” Coach Stan Van Gundy said. “There’s not going to be anything magical happening at the start of the playoffs. I’ve never been a big flip the switch guy. But that’s what our guys are trying to do now. If we play the way we did these last two home games, there’s not a team in the league we can win a series against."

          The Favorite is 8-2 ATS in the last 10 meetings.
          The Under is 7-1 in the last 8 meetings.

          Key Injuries - G Jameer Nelson (16.7 ppg, missed the last 32 games) is OUT for the season.

          PROJECTED SCORE: 99 (UNDER - Total Play of the Day)

          Nets: The Nets’ last five games have come against Eastern playoff teams, and they’ve won both games at home and dropped all three on the road. Their latest setback came Friday night in Detroit, when Devin Harris scored just one point in 20 minutes before leaving with a shoulder injury in the third quarter of the 100-93 loss. Harris' status for Saturday’s game is uncertain. New Jersey will be looking to snap a four-game losing streak to the Magic. The Nets lost their last two at home in this series by an average of 17.5 points.

          The Nets are 12-3-1 ATS in their last 16 vs. Eastern Conference foes.
          The Under is 6-1 in the Nets' last 7 home games..

          Key Injuries - G Devin Harris (21.5 ppg, 6.9 apg) is DOUBTFUL (shoulder).

          PROJECTED SCORE: 94

            Toronto Blue Jays at Cleveland Indians [1:05 PM ET]

            Blue Jays: (-125, O/U 8): Roy Halladay had been 5-0 lifetime against Cleveland until last season, when he lost both of his outings while giving up eight runs - five earned - over 12 2-3 innings. In his last 11 starts against Cleveland, Halladay is 5-2 with a 3.78 ERA and 1.33 WHIP. He got the win in his season debut vs. Detroit, allowing 5 earned runs on 7 hits (2 homers) in 7 innings. The Blue Jays are hitting .287 and scoring 6 runs per game so far this season, but this will be their first game against a lefty starter in '09.

            Toronto is 3-15 in their last 18 games at Cleveland.
            The Over is 8-1 in Halladay's last 9 starts overall.

            Key Injuries - NONE

            PROJECTED SCORE: 5 (Side Play of the Day)

            Indians: Cliff Lee got pounded for seven runs and 10 hits in five innings in his season debut at Texas. All the runs came after the Rangers’ Hank Blalock hit a one-hopper off his forearm, but Lee refused to use that as an excuse. “It’s fine. I got it in the forearm. It’ll probably be a little sore, but it’ll be fine. I don’t think it affected my pitches,” he said. Lee is 1-3 with a 4.02 ERA and 1.41 WHIP in 7 career starts vs. Toronto. Lee was fantastic against the Blue Jays last season, throwing 17 scoreless innings over two starts.

            The Indians are 23-8 in Lee's last 31 starts.
            The Over is 7-0-1 in Lee's last 8 starts as a home underdog.

            Key Injuries - NONE

            PROJECTED SCORE: 3

                              Saturday's List of 13: Odds and ends on baseball salaries

                              13) Was surprised that only four Boston Red Sox are earning more than $10M this year; was more surprised that JD Drew makes $14M and is the highest-paid player on the team. Do me and my fantasy team a big favor-- save some room for Matt Holliday next year.

                              12) Bronx Bombers have nine players making $13M+ this year, with Alex Rodriguez getting paid $33M this season.

                              11) The three lowest payrolls this year: Florida $36,834,000
                              San Diego $43,734,200.........Pittsburgh $48,693,000.

                              10) Four highest payrolls: Bronx $201,449,189, Mets $149,373,987 Red Sox $121,745,999.............Detroit $115,085,145.

                              9) Overall, major league payrolls are down $47M this season.

                              8) Underpaid players: Tampa Bay's Evan Longoria, $550,000, James Shields $1.5M; Russell Martin $3.9M, Jose Reyes $6.125M.

                              7) Overpaid (or, isn't this a great country) players: Gary Sheffield, $14M, Jeff Suppan $12,750,000, Carlos Silva $12,250,000.

                              6) Travis Hafner made $11.5M LY. He knocked in 24 runs.

                              5) Colorado must have to overpay to get pitchers to come to Denver: Kevin Marquis makes $9.875M, Aaron Cook $9.375M.

                              4) Rafael Furcal turned down $40M for four years from the A's-- he is making $7.5M from the Dodgers. Go figure.

                              3) Minnesota only has five guys making more than $3M this year.

                              2) Of 27 guys listed on Oakland's roster, 17 make $420,000 or less.

                              1) Tampa Bay may be the defending AL champ, but they still have the lowest payroll in the AL East-- $63,313,034.
